The Amazon Robot and Human Synergy

With the increase in demands and rise in expectations, Amazon started the machine to human where machines help humans to carry goods from one location to the packing region in the fulfilment center. This started in 2012 and since then, although it has reduced the numbers of employees that could have been employed into the company, it has also improved productivity and the company hopes to become a fully automated company in the nearest future. Currently, Amazon has about 40% of its workforce as robots and it hopes that in the nearest future, it will be able to automate every single order.

Amazon has bought a lot of robotics companies so as to reach its robotic goals, companies like Dispatch, Kiva Robots which is now Amazon Robotics, Zoox and many more. From automated delivery robots, to robotic gears worn by employees, and so on. Gradually, Amazon is becoming a fully automated.
